What Saxagliptin Anhydrous does in the body

The pancreas makes more insulin after meals and less glucagon, and the liver stops pushing out extra sugar.

Eating triggers the gut to release hormones that tell the pancreas to release insulin — but only while blood sugar is actually high, which is why they do not cause hypoglycaemia. An enzyme circulating in the blood chews those hormones up within a couple of minutes. Saxagliptin plugs that enzyme, so the hormones survive longer and their signal is stronger.

Exposure to both saxagliptin and its active 5-hydroxy metabolite rises proportionally from 2.5 to 400 mg, variability is under 25%, and neither accumulates on repeated once-daily dosing. Both are renally eliminated, so the strength appropriate to a given level of kidney function is a prescribing decision this page does not enter into.

    GLP-1 is released from intestinal L cells and GIP from K cells in response to nutrient arrival. The label states these hormones cause insulin release from pancreatic beta cells in a glucose-dependent manner. In type 2 diabetes GLP-1 concentrations are reduced while the insulin response to GLP-1 is preserved.

    Dipeptidyl peptidase-4 removes the N-terminal dipeptide from GLP-1 and GIP, inactivating them within minutes of release. The half-life of intact active GLP-1 in plasma is of the order of a couple of minutes, which is what makes the enzyme, rather than the hormone, the practical drug target.

    The cyanopyrrolidine nitrile forms a slowly reversible covalent adduct with the catalytic serine of DPP-4, giving competitive inhibition with a long residence time. Selectivity over the closely related DPP-8 and DPP-9 enzymes is a design requirement of the class, not an incidental property.

    The label states saxagliptin reduces fasting and post-prandial glucose "in a glucose-dependent manner". That dependence is the reason a DPP-4 inhibitor alone does not cause hypoglycaemia, and it is also the reason the effect size is modest compared with drugs that force insulin release unconditionally.

    GLP-1 raises glucose-dependent insulin secretion from beta cells and lowers glucagon secretion from alpha cells, reducing hepatic glucose production. Both arms contribute to the fall in fasting and post-prandial glucose that the label describes.

    In SAVOR-TIMI 53, the primary composite hazard ratio was 1.00 (95% CI 0.89 to 1.12) and hospitalisation for heart failure 1.27 (95% CI 1.07 to 1.51, p=0.007). The mechanism of the heart-failure signal is unresolved; DPP-4 has substrates beyond the incretins, including stromal cell-derived factor-1 and brain natriuretic peptide, which is a hypothesis rather than a demonstrated cause.

Worth asking a clinician aboutWritten into the record from the studies named on this page

Saxagliptin alone does not cause hypoglycaemia, because the incretin signal it prolongs is itself glucose-dependent; combined with insulin or an insulin secretagogue the risk rises. Section 5.2 of the label carries the SAVOR heart-failure finding with its trial counts and asks prescribers to weigh risks and benefits in patients at higher risk, to monitor, and to consider discontinuation if heart failure develops. Postmarketing reports underlie warnings for acute pancreatitis, serious hypersensitivity including anaphylaxis and angioedema, severe and disabling arthralgia, and bullous pemphigoid requiring hospitalisation. It is not recommended in type 1 diabetes or diabetic ketoacidosis.

SAVOR-TIMI 53 found 27% more hospitalisations for heart failure
In plain words
The trial required to prove saxagliptin did not cause harm found harm — not the harm it was looking for. Heart attacks and strokes were unchanged. Admissions to hospital for heart failure rose from 2.8% to 3.5%, and the finding is now printed on the label.

SAVOR-TIMI 53 randomised 16,492 patients with type 2 diabetes who had a history of, or were at risk for, cardiovascular events to saxagliptin or placebo, with physicians free to adjust other therapy, and followed them a median 2.1 years. More patients on saxagliptin were hospitalised for heart failure: 3.5% against 2.8%, hazard ratio 1.27 (95% CI 1.07 to 1.51, p=0.007). The FDA label reproduces the counts — 289 of 8,280 against 228 of 8,212 — and adds that patients with prior heart failure and those with renal impairment were at higher risk irrespective of treatment assignment. Section 5.2 of the label instructs prescribers to consider the risks and benefits before initiating in patients at higher risk of heart failure, to observe for signs and symptoms during therapy, to advise patients of the characteristic symptoms and to report them immediately, and to consider discontinuation if heart failure develops.

On the endpoint it was built to test, the result was exactly nothing
In plain words
The primary endpoint was cardiovascular death, heart attack or ischaemic stroke. It happened to 7.3% of the saxagliptin group and 7.2% of the placebo group. The hazard ratio was 1.00.

A primary endpoint event occurred in 613 patients on saxagliptin and 609 on placebo — 7.3% and 7.2% by two-year Kaplan-Meier estimate — hazard ratio 1.00 (95% CI 0.89 to 1.12), p=0.99 for superiority and p<0.001 for non-inferiority. The on-treatment analysis agreed at 1.03 (95% CI 0.91 to 1.17). The major secondary endpoint, a broader composite adding hospitalisation for unstable angina, coronary revascularisation and heart failure, occurred in 1,059 against 1,034 patients — 12.8% and 12.4% — hazard ratio 1.02 (95% CI 0.94 to 1.11, p=0.66). The trial authors concluded that DPP-4 inhibition with saxagliptin did not increase or decrease the rate of ischaemic events, and that "although saxagliptin improves glycemic control, other approaches are necessary to reduce cardiovascular risk in patients with diabetes."

This is the trial that justified making outcome trials compulsory
In plain words
After rosiglitazone, the FDA started requiring every new diabetes drug to prove it did not increase cardiovascular risk. Saxagliptin was among the first drugs put through that requirement, and it was the first whose trial found a problem the licensing programme had missed entirely.

The DPP-4 inhibitors were licensed on HbA1c in phase 3 programmes that were not designed or powered to detect a difference in heart-failure hospitalisation. The signal in SAVOR-TIMI 53 emerged only because 16,492 patients were followed with adjudicated endpoints over a median 2.1 years — roughly two orders of magnitude more patient-years than a registration programme provides. The consequence was a labelling change rather than a withdrawal: the current United States label devotes a numbered warnings section to heart failure and reproduces the trial counts. The same class effect discussion appears on the alogliptin label. What changed was not the drug but what is known about it, and the mechanism by which that knowledge arrived was a regulatory requirement introduced because of a different drug entirely.

Acute pancreatitis was numerically higher and not statistically distinguishable
In plain words
Pancreatitis was the safety worry that dominated discussion of this class before the trial. In 16,413 patients it occurred in 17 on saxagliptin and 9 on placebo — 0.2% against 0.1%.

The FDA label reports that in SAVOR, definite acute pancreatitis was confirmed in 17 of 8,240 patients receiving saxagliptin (0.2%) against 9 of 8,173 receiving placebo (0.1%). Pre-existing risk factors for pancreatitis were identified in 15 of the 17 saxagliptin cases (88%) and in all 9 placebo cases. The published trial reports rates of adjudicated acute pancreatitis as similar between groups at 0.3% and 0.2%, and chronic pancreatitis at below 0.1% and 0.1%. The label nonetheless carries a numbered pancreatitis warning on the strength of postmarketing reports, instructing prompt discontinuation if pancreatitis is suspected. Twenty-six events across sixteen thousand patients is a small enough number that the confidence interval around any ratio would be wide, and the label does not present one.

Two class harms were only discovered after approval
In plain words
Severe disabling joint pain and a blistering skin disease serious enough to require hospital admission were both added to the labels of this drug class from postmarketing reports, not from the trials that licensed them.

The current saxagliptin label carries two warnings derived entirely from postmarketing surveillance. Section 5.5 states that severe and disabling arthralgia has been reported in patients taking DPP-4 inhibitors, and instructs prescribers to consider the drug as a possible cause of severe joint pain and to discontinue if appropriate. Section 5.6 states that there have been postmarketing reports of bullous pemphigoid requiring hospitalisation in patients taking DPP-4 inhibitors, instructs that patients be told to report blisters or erosions, and requires discontinuation if bullous pemphigoid is suspected. Section 5.4 records postmarketing reports of serious hypersensitivity reactions including anaphylaxis, angioedema and exfoliative skin conditions. None of these appeared in the registration programme; all are class findings that accumulated after tens of millions of patient-exposures.

The active metabolite carries three times the exposure of the parent drug
In plain words
The liver converts saxagliptin into a second compound that also blocks the enzyme, and there is about three times as much of it in the blood. Both are cleared by the kidney, so kidney function changes total active drug more than a parent-drug measurement suggests.

The label reports that after a single 5 mg oral dose in healthy subjects, mean plasma area under the curve was 78 ng·h/mL for saxagliptin and 214 ng·h/mL for the active metabolite 5-hydroxysaxagliptin, with peak concentrations of 24 and 47 ng/mL respectively. Exposure to both increases proportionally from 2.5 to 400 mg, variability is under 25%, and neither accumulates on repeated once-daily dosing. Formation of the metabolite is by CYP3A4 and CYP3A5, so strong inhibitors of those enzymes shift the parent-to-metabolite ratio. Both species are renally eliminated. A page describing this drug purely in terms of the parent compound is describing a quarter of the circulating active material.

A competitive inhibitor of the enzyme that destroys the gut hormones GLP-1 and GIP, which lowers blood sugar without causing hypoglycaemia on its own — and which, in a 16,492-patient randomised trial, changed the rate of cardiovascular death, heart attack and ischaemic stroke by nothing at all (hazard ratio 1.00) while raising hospitalisation for heart failure by 27% (hazard ratio 1.27, 95% CI 1.07 to 1.51, p=0.007), a finding now written into its label.
